# Thumbnail generation queue settings (Pellwick media service).
# Reviewer note: the queue drains via three workers; concurrency above
# three caused lock contention on the variants table during load tests,
# so please flag any change to that value. Retries are capped at five
# with exponential backoff starting at 2s. Failed jobs land in the
# dead-letter table for manual inspection. The workers record job state
# in the media database, reached via the connection string below.

primary connection of tawif-yajeg = postgresql://rusiel_svc:G879q9cx6GsSvj@db-dd9f.norvagrid.internal:5432/casath

## Firmware Update Channel

Review changes to the Larkspur update channel carefully: it pushes firmware to all Bramblewick kiosks nightly. Any merge to `channel-stable` triggers a signed build and staged rollout within an hour. Reviewers must confirm the rollout plan in the PR description. If a change looks risky or you're unsure about gating, contact the release steward below.

alerts address for bajop-yahog: istwyn@lumiclabs.internal

Changed defaults in Splitfork, our assignment service. Bucketing now uses sticky hashing per account instead of per session, and the holdout slice grew from 2% to 5%. Callers relying on session-level reassignment must opt in explicitly. Review the diff against the new baseline; the updated default configuration is listed below.

config for tagep-kajof:
[casir]
port = 6379
region = south-1
host = casir.paliqdyn.example
team = tamax
timeout_ms = 250
retries = 2

TICKET: Renderloft transcode farm — vault locked after three failed unseal attempts. Node farm-west sealed itself during the Quillbrook datacenter power blip. Do not retry unseal manually; that resets the counter and extends lockout. Use the break-glass recovery flow in the Renderloft ops wiki, section 4. Future maintainers: this happens roughly twice a year, stop re-diagnosing it. The recovery passphrase for the farm vault is below.

vault phrase of tajef-tafog = istox-sorax-zorox-casok-holox-kelix-weneth-drueth-casion